The video discusses the Sherpa people, who are native to Eastern Tibet near Mount Everest. Known for their expertise in the region, the term 'Sherpa' is now used for anyone guiding climbers up Mount Everest. Sherpas play a crucial role in ensuring the safety of tourists during the climb.
